Abstract

The present invention relates to long acting ammonium sulfate which exists in the form of a eutectic mixture of dicyanodiamide and ammonium sulfate, and the content of the dicyanodiamide is 0.3 wt% to 4 wt% of the ammonium sulfate. A preparation method comprises that after the dicyanodiamide is dissolved (with water or ammonium hydroxide), the dissolved dicyanodiamide is pumped by a metering pump into a reaction vessel for synthesizing the ammonium sulfate and is thoroughly mixed with a reaction solution, the solution after reacting is concentrated by the conventional technology, and the dicyanodiamide and the ammonium sulfate are crystallized, dewatered and dried. A fertilizer of the present invention has a long acting period, and the utilization rate of nitrogen is 10% higher than that of the common ammonium sulfate. Using the long acting fertilizer to replace the ammonium sulfate not only can obtain the aim of increasing both production and income, but also can reduce the discharge capacity of gas discharged by small farmland and causes atmosphere greenhouse effect so as to obtain obvious economic benefits and social benefits.

Description

Long-acting ammonium sulphate and preparation method thereof
The invention provides a kind of long-acting ammonium sulfate chemical fertilizer, specifically contain long-acting sulfuric acid of dihydro-amine and preparation method thereof.
Ammonium sulfate claims the sulphur ammonium again, it is one of important solid nitrogen fertilizers of more application in the present agricultural, nitrogenous 21%, be used in paddy rice, corn, cotton, fruit tree and the forestry in the nursery stock fertilising more, particularly on the vegetables (as: celery, lettuce) of happiness sulphur and tea tree, use more.Therefore, the sulphur ammonium is not only as nitrogenous fertilizer, and use as sulfur fertilizer, along with the change (high concentration fertilizer is sulfur-bearing no longer) of nitrogen fertilizers and the introducing of high-yield crop (they absorb a large amount of sulphur), make the lack of soil sulfur phenomenon outstanding day by day, the countries and regions that have are to not executing the stage that sulfur fertilizer just can not increase production.But the sulphur ammonium is as a kind of product nitrogenous fertilizer material, and its utilization ratio only is 30~43%, and its loss approach mainly is the NO that causes under nitrated-denitrification 3 -Leaching loss and N 2The airborne release of O.The nitrogen utilization efficiency of thiamine fertilizer is low to be the one of the main reasons that influences its application.
The applicant once proposed to adopt the interpolation Dyhard RU 100 to prepare long-acting ammonium bicarbonate chemical fertilizer (CN 1053225A) in early days, mainly contain dihydro-amine and coal-based a kind of nitrogenous fertilizer long-acting synergist (CN 1109038A) adds in bicarbonate of ammonia or the urea, the fertilizer efficiency period of chemical fertilizer can be prolonged, and the technology of the nitrogen utilization efficiency of chemical fertilizer can be improved.This technology mainly is the inhibiting nitrification effect that utilizes Dyhard RU 100 to have, and can stop the conversion process of the ammonium nitrogen of nitrogenous fertilizer to nitric nitrogen, reduces and reduce the leaching loss and the volatilization loss of nitrogenous fertilizer.But with the method for Dyhard RU 100, directly add in the ammonium sulfate, or nitrogenous fertilizer long-acting synergist is added in the ammonium sulfate, all can not obviously increase the fertilizer efficiency period of ammonium sulfate and improve its nitrogen utilization efficiency effectively with mechanically mixing.Have not yet to see the relevant report that improves the practical technique aspect of ammonium sulfate performance.
The objective of the invention is to solve the ammonium sulfate nitrogen and utilize low problem, a kind of long-acting ammonium sulfate and preparation method thereof is provided.The fertilizer efficiency period of this chemical fertilizer is long, and its nitrogen utilization efficiency is also than common ammonium sulfate high nearly 5~8%.Use this long-acting fertilizer to replace ammonium sulfate, not only can receive the purpose of increasing both production and income, also can reduce the quantity discharged that the farmland discharging causes the atmosphere greenhouse gases, protected physical environment.
Long-acting ammonium sulfate provided by the invention still adopts a kind of ammonium nitrate chemical fertilizer that contains Dyhard RU 100 that adds Dyhard RU 100 and obtain, and it is characterized in that Dyhard RU 100 and ammonium sulfate exist for the eutectic mixture form, and the content of Dyhard RU 100 is 0.3~4% of ammonium nitrate weight; Dyhard RU 100 and ammonium sulfate that so-called eutectic mixture form exists are in the building-up process of ammonium sulfate, and Dyhard RU 100 is joined in the reaction soln, mix, then the product that obtains after dehydration and drying.
The preparation method of concrete long-acting ammonium sulfate is as follows:
1. with after the Dyhard RU 100 dissolving (water or ammoniacal liquor), be input to volume pump in the reactor of synthetic ammonium sulfate and the reaction soln thorough mixing;
Again routinely technology back solution concentrates to reacting, Dyhard RU 100 and ammonium sulfate cocrystallization, dehydration and drying make finished product.
Long-acting ammonium sulphate of the present invention also can be as the carrier of micronutrient element, as: boron, manganese, molybdenum, zinc etc., produce the long-acting composite sulfur ammonium that contains multiple little fertilizer.Simultaneously this long-acting ammonium sulphate also can with present production in the middle of various special-purpose fertile (nitrogenous, phosphorus, potassium) of using be mixed with long acting special compound fertilizer.Make various long acting special compound fertilizers flexibly according to the fertility level of different soils and the nutrient uptake feature of raise crop.
Below by embodiment technology of the present invention is given to illustrate further.
The preparation of embodiment 1 long-acting ammonium sulphate
In the technical process of synthetic sulphur ammonium, set up a dissolving tank and volume pump, Dyhard RU 100 solution in the dissolving tank is quantitatively pumped in the synthetic sulphur ammonium reactor, technology is operated and can be obtained long-acting ammonium sulphate routinely again.
The application of embodiment 2 long-acting ammonium sulphates
Utilize the preparation method of embodiment 1, when adding the amount of different Dyhard RU 100s, contain the different sulphur ammonium of Dyhard RU 100, under the identical condition in field, make the ammonium stability experiment obtaining, and with common sulphur ammonium as a comparison, its result such as table 1.

Result by table 1, when the content of Dyhard RU 100 is crossed (<0.3%) when low, limited to the effect that improves sulphur ammonium nitrogen utilization efficiency, and during too high levels (>4%), can not more effective raising nitrogen utilization efficiency, and higher because of the price of Dyhard RU 100, too much use will increase the cost of long-acting ammonium sulphate chemical fertilizer, and it is 1~3% more suitable generally containing with it.
Comparative example 1 Dyhard RU 100 adds the influence of form to sulphur ammonium nitrogen utilization efficiency
Utilize the method for embodiment 1 to prepare long-acting ammonium sulphate, the mixture with equivalent Dyhard RU 100 and sulphur ammonium obtain by the mechanically mixing method compares experiment under embodiment 2 the same terms, and it the results are shown in table 2.

1. with the Dyhard RU 100 of volume of ammonium sulfate 3% and sulphur ammonium mechanically mixing evenly (pressing CN 1053225A technology);
2. utilize nitrogenous fertilizer long-acting synergist (CN 1109038A technology), making the Dyhard RU 100 addition is 3% sulphur ammonium mixed fertilizer.
Result by table 2 can see in the identical various ammonium sulfate fertilizers of Dyhard RU 100 content, having the effect of the most tangible raising nitrogen utilization efficiency by the fertilizer of method preparation of the present invention.Because method provided by the invention is simple, facility investment is few, is suitable for applying simultaneously.
